Team Malta
In San Marino GSSE 2017

Archery
Daniel Schembri, Patrick Zammit.

Athletics
Luke Bezzina, Matthew Croker, Charlton Debono, Ian Paul Grech, Daniel Saliba, Lisa Marie Bezzina, Francesca Borg, Sarah Busuttil, Mona Lisa Camilleri, Antonella Chouhal, Peppijna Dalli, Rachel Fitz, Janet Richard, Rebecca Sare, Roberta Schembri, Annalise Vassallo, Joanne Vella, Charlotte Wingfield.

Basketball
Hanna Al-Tumi, Maria Bonett, Samantha Marie Brincat, Elena Cassar, Christina Curmi, Stephanie De Martino, Christina Grima, Josephine Grima, Nicola Handreck, Gabriella Mifsud, Sarah Jayne Pace, Ashleigh Vella.

Beach Volley
Dorianne Bonnici, Gertrude Zarb, Robert Balzan, Manuel Raffa.

Boules (Raffa)
David Farrugia, Reno Farrugia, Stefan Farrugia, Giuseppe Gemelli.

Cycling
Etienne Bonello, Maurice Formosa, James Mifsud, Alexander Pettett, Patrick Scicluna, Stephanie Alden, Marie Claire Aquilina, Michelle Vella Wood.

Judo
Rodney Zammit.

Shooting
Gianluca Azzopardi Spiteri, Gianluca Chetcuti, William Chetcuti, Bozhidar Dimitrov, Clive Farrugia, Brian Galea, Francis Pace, William Vella, Eleonor Bezzina.

Swimming
Jeremy Bugeja, Andrew Chetcuti, Matthew Galea, Michael Stafrace, Mikhail Umnov, Thomas Wareing, Matthew Zammit, Mya Azzopardi, Francesca Falzon Young, Alexandra Mcgonigle, Amy Micallef, Leah Tanti.

Table Tennis
Viktoria Lucenkova, Jessica Pace.

Tennis
Matthew Asciak, Omar Sudzuka, Francesca Curmi, Elaine Genovese.

Volleyball
Amanda Agius, Daniela Bonnici, Alison Borg, Lindsay Cordina, Maria Anne Costa, Isabel Cutajar, Sarah El Gasi, Marjoe Falzon, Thais Gatt, Zane Malasevksa, Francesca Sarcina, Sarah Spiteri.

Results – G (4) | S (9) | B (16)

Chef de Mission – Mr William Beck

Flag Bearer – | Ms Charlotte Wingfield

Established in 1928, the Maltese Olympic Committee is the supreme and exclusive authority on matters relating to Malta’s representation at all games falling under the jurisdiction of the International Olympic Committee. The Committee’s main commitment is that of encouraging, promoting and funding of Maltese participation in the Olympic Games.
